TDOC Employee Jailed For Bringing Contraband Into Prison

By Ronni Chase Jan 17, 2021 | 7:13 PM

A Tennessee Department of Corrections employee found himself behind bars after he allegedly tried to bring contraband into the Riverbend Maximum Security Institution.  According to reports, 26-year-old William Chamberlain was reporting for work Friday morning when he was busted at the security checkpoint with tobacco, marijuana and cash.  Chamberlain was booked into the Davidson County Jail and charged with Introduction of Contraband.  He was also fired from TDOC.
